Job Title: Architect Privacy and Compliance Solutions Job Location: Hershey, PA or Remote This position is open to 100% remote. Summary: Provide technical leadership, execute day-to-day solution support, and lead technical implementations for various consumer, customer, employee compliance technologies. Currently Hershey's Compliance Technologies consist primary of Adobe Experience Platform and OneTrust. This role will provide technical leadership across but primarily focus on OneTrust as the core of our compliance technologies. The Hershey Company's Information Services (IS) department supports these critical platforms to support our legal & business partners in driving growth, consumer engagement, and compliance. Major Duties/Responsibilities: Day to Day management and administration of across the OneTrust platform as required by the role. Provide architectural leadership and support for OneTrust Solutions as required. Help to support the day-to-day operations of full-filling compliance requests by providing support to compliance operations analysts and team. Coordinate and configure new consent requirements in OneTrust's Preference & Consent Management solutions as required by the role. Support updates regarding privacy policies and other related items in OneTrust's ethic's and compliance solution. Configure new PIA and DPIA in OneTrust as required by business or legal. Management and maintenance of enterprise data mapping for privacy solutions in OneTrust. Support the compliance integration team with the system administration of privacy rights automation in OneTrust. Diagnose and track down any functional issues to a root or functional cause, and resolve issues as needed. Coordinate with compliance ops team on proper handling of consumer PII within compliance systems.
